The Meadowbrook Mobile Homes serves a community with a median household income of $100,882 and an estimated 5,327 residents across its service area. Approximately 58%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.

💧 Where Does Your Water Come From?

Groundwater

Meadowbrook Mobile Homes's water is pumped from underground aquifers. Groundwater is naturally filtered through rock and soil, but it can be vulnerable to PFAS contamination, nitrates from agriculture, and industrial chemicals that seep into the water table.

System Overview

Meadowbrook Mobile Homes (EPA ID: PA3480008) is a community water system in Pennsylvania that serves approximately 60 people from groundwater sources.

This system serves ZIP code 19504 in Barto.

Violation History

No violations recorded — This water system has no recorded EPA violations in the past 5 years.

This system reports zero confirmed lead service lines in its inventory. Unknown-material counts may still warrant verification.

Federal LCRI rule (effective October 2024) requires every public water system to inventory its service lines and complete lead-line replacement within 10 years.
